/**
|
|
|
|
|
* Routing for Tauri's *native* drag-drop event.
|
|
|
|
|
*
|
|
|
|
|
* The listener is window-wide — every pane that wants dropped file paths gets
|
|
|
|
|
* the same event — so each one decides for itself whether the drop was meant
|
|
|
|
|
* for it. That decision used to be purely geometric: is the payload position
|
|
|
|
|
* inside my rect? A rect is not what the user sees, though. An open `Modal` is
|
|
|
|
|
* a `fixed inset-0` portal at `z-50` painted *over* the whole window, and the
|
|
|
|
|
* pane underneath still had its rect, so releasing a drag onto a dialog
|
|
|
|
|
* uploaded the file into the directory the dialog was covering. Same for the
|
|
|
|
|
* shutdown overlay, which is on screen precisely while nothing should be
|
|
|
|
|
* accepting work at all.
|
|
|
|
|
*
|
2026-08-23 13:03:57 -07:00
|
|
|
* So the hit test is: the point is inside my rect, **and** nothing that
|
|
|
|
|
* *swallows* drops is painted at that point.
|
|
|
|
|
*
|
|
|
|
|
* ## The question the z-order test asks — and the one it must not ask
|
|
|
|
|
*
|
|
|
|
|
* The first version of this asked `el.contains(document.elementFromPoint(x,y))`
|
|
|
|
|
* — "is the thing painted here mine?" That is the wrong question, and it
|
|
|
|
|
* created permanent dead zones. Panes have chrome painted *over* them that is
|
|
|
|
|
* not part of the element handed to this function and does not swallow
|
|
|
|
|
* anything: `TerminalView`'s always-present "▼ Following" button, the URL
|
|
|
|
|
* toast, and `ToastHost`'s bottom-right stack — which is `fixed` at `z-[60]`
|
|
|
|
|
* over *every* pane and whose error cards stay until dismissed. Under the
|
|
|
|
|
* containment rule a drop onto any of them was silently refused, forever.
|
|
|
|
|
*
|
|
|
|
|
* The question that matches the intent is "is a *blocking overlay* painted
|
|
|
|
|
* here?". A button, a toast or a tooltip over the pane is not one; a modal
|
|
|
|
|
* backdrop is. Anything else painted at the point belongs to the pane's own
|
|
|
|
|
* subtree or is chrome that is happy for the drop to fall through to it.
|
|
|
|
|
*
|
|
|
|
|
* That rule is also what *scopes* the blocking question. `dropIsBlocked` is
|
|
|
|
|
* document-wide, and `ui/Modal` portals to `document.body`, so any dialog
|
|
|
|
|
* anywhere used to refuse every drop in the window. Asking per-point means a
|
|
|
|
|
* dialog only refuses the points it actually covers.
|
|
|
|
|
*
|
|
|
|
|
* ## jsdom
|
|
|
|
|
*
|
|
|
|
|
* jsdom implements no layout and has no `elementFromPoint`, so the z-order
|
|
|
|
|
* branch cannot be exercised by simply rendering — which is exactly how the
|
|
|
|
|
* containment bug shipped green through 81 drop tests. Every test that cares
|
|
|
|
|
* about z-order therefore stubs `elementFromPoint` (see `dropTarget.test.ts`),
|
|
|
|
|
* and the fallback below — when there is no such API, or it cannot resolve the
|
|
|
|
|
* point — is the conservative document-wide question this used to ask.
|
2026-08-23 11:11:43 -07:00
|
|
|
*/

/**
|
|
|
|
|
* Anything that swallows a drop wherever it lands.
|
|
|
|
|
*
|
|
|
|
|
* `[aria-modal="true"]` is every dialog in the app for free — `ui/Modal` is
|
|
|
|
|
* the only way one is built, and it sets that attribute. `data-blocks-drop`
|
2026-08-23 13:03:57 -07:00
|
|
|
* is for full-window overlays that are not dialogs (the shutdown overlay), and
|
|
|
|
|
* `ui/Modal` puts it on its backdrop as well: the backdrop is what
|
|
|
|
|
* `elementFromPoint` returns for a point outside the dialog panel, and it is
|
|
|
|
|
* the element that is really covering the pane.
|
2026-08-23 11:11:43 -07:00
|
|
|
*/
|
|
|
|
|
const BLOCKING_SELECTOR = '[aria-modal="true"],[data-blocks-drop="true"]';

/**
|
|
|
|
|
* Whether the drop payload's coordinates are physical device pixels.
|
|
|
|
|
*
|
|
|
|
|
* **Only Windows delivers physical pixels.** `wry`'s WebView2 drag-drop
|
|
|
|
|
* handler reads the point from the OS in device pixels and passes it through
|
|
|
|
|
* (`wry/src/webview2/drag_drop.rs`), while the macOS and GTK backends deliver
|
|
|
|
|
* logical points and `tauri-runtime-wry`'s forwarding does not rescale them.
|
|
|
|
|
* Dividing by `devicePixelRatio` unconditionally therefore halved every drop
|
|
|
|
|
* position on a HiDPI Mac or Linux box — which used to be a silent
|
|
|
|
|
* mis-aimed-but-usually-still-inside-the-pane error and, with a z-order test
|
|
|
|
|
* in place, becomes a drop refused because the *halved* point lands on
|
|
|
|
|
* something else.
|
|
|
|
|
*
|
|
|
|
|
* Verified by reading the wry/tauri sources named above. **Not** verified on a
|
|
|
|
|
* real HiDPI macOS or GTK machine — neither is available here — which is why
|
|
|
|
|
* the divisor is platform-conditional rather than simply deleted: the Windows
|
|
|
|
|
* behaviour is the one covered by tests and by the shipped code path.
|
|
|
|
|
*/
|
|
|
|
|
function payloadIsPhysical(
|
|
|
|
|
view: (Window & typeof globalThis) | null,
|
|
|
|
|
options: DropTargetOptions,
|
|
|
|
|
): boolean {
|
|
|
|
|
if (options.physicalPixelPayload !== undefined) return options.physicalPixelPayload;
|
|
|
|
|
return /windows/i.test(view?.navigator?.userAgent ?? "");
|
2026-08-23 11:11:43 -07:00
|
|
|
}

/**
|
2026-08-23 13:03:57 -07:00
|
|
|
* Why a native drop at `pos` did or did not belong to `el`.
|
|
|
|
|
*
|
|
|
|
|
* - `accept` — it is ours.
|
|
|
|
|
* - `blocked` — it landed on our rect, but a modal or a blocking overlay is
|
|
|
|
|
* painted there and swallowed it. Worth *saying* to the user: the drop
|
|
|
|
|
* visibly did nothing.
|
|
|
|
|
* - `elsewhere` — not our drop. Silence is the right response; some other
|
|
|
|
|
* pane's listener is about to accept it.
|
2026-08-23 11:11:43 -07:00
|
|
|
*
|
|
|
|
|
* A hidden pane is `display:none` and therefore has a zero-size rect, which is
|
|
|
|
|
* what stops two panes both claiming the same drop.
|
|
|
|
|
*/
|
2026-08-23 13:03:57 -07:00
|
|
|
export type DropVerdict = "accept" | "blocked" | "elsewhere";
|
|
|
|
|
|
|
|
|
|
export function classifyDrop(
|
2026-08-23 11:11:43 -07:00
|
|
|
el: HTMLElement | null | undefined,
|
|
|
|
|
pos: DropPoint,
|
|
|
|
|
options: DropTargetOptions = {},
|
2026-08-23 13:03:57 -07:00
|
|
|
): DropVerdict {
|
2026-08-23 11:11:43 -07:00
|
|
|
const doc = options.doc ?? el?.ownerDocument ?? document;
|
|
|
|
|
|
|
|
|
|
const rect = el?.getBoundingClientRect();
|
2026-08-23 13:03:57 -07:00
|
|
|
if (!el || !rect || rect.width === 0 || rect.height === 0) return "elsewhere";
|
2026-08-23 11:11:43 -07:00
|
|
|
|
2026-08-23 13:03:57 -07:00
|
|
|
const view = doc.defaultView;
|
2026-08-23 11:11:43 -07:00
|
|
|
const dpr =
|
|
|
|
|
options.devicePixelRatio ??
|
2026-08-23 13:03:57 -07:00
|
|
|
(payloadIsPhysical(view, options) ? view?.devicePixelRatio || 1 : 1);
|
2026-08-23 11:11:43 -07:00
|
|
|
const x = pos.x / dpr;
|
|
|
|
|
const y = pos.y / dpr;
|
|
|
|
|
if (x < rect.left || x > rect.right || y < rect.top || y > rect.bottom) {
|
2026-08-23 13:03:57 -07:00
|
|
|
return "elsewhere";
|
2026-08-23 11:11:43 -07:00
|
|
|
}
|
|
|
|
|
|
|
|
|
|
// Z-order, where the environment can answer it. `elementFromPoint` skips
|
|
|
|
|
// `pointer-events: none`, so the pane's own decorative drop hint does not
|
2026-08-23 13:03:57 -07:00
|
|
|
// count as something covering it.
|
|
|
|
|
const top =
|
|
|
|
|
typeof doc.elementFromPoint === "function" ? doc.elementFromPoint(x, y) : null;
|
|
|
|
|
if (top && top !== doc.body && top !== doc.documentElement) {
|
|
|
|
|
return coveredByBlocker(top, doc) ? "blocked" : "accept";
|
2026-08-23 11:11:43 -07:00
|
|
|
}
|
|
|
|
|
|
2026-08-23 13:03:57 -07:00
|
|
|
// No layout information — jsdom, or a point the view could not resolve. Fall
|
|
|
|
|
// back to the document-wide question, which is the conservative answer: a
|
|
|
|
|
// dialog somewhere refuses everything rather than risking a drop landing
|
|
|
|
|
// underneath one.
|
|
|
|
|
return dropIsBlocked(doc) ? "blocked" : "accept";
|
|
|
|
|
}

/**
|
|
|
|
|
* Is the element painted at the drop point part of something that swallows
|
|
|
|
|
* drops?
|
|
|
|
|
*
|
|
|
|
|
* Two directions, because a dialog is two elements: the panel carries
|
|
|
|
|
* `aria-modal`, and the backdrop around it is what is painted over the pane.
|
|
|
|
|
* `ui/Modal` marks its own backdrop, so `closest` covers both; the `contains`
|
|
|
|
|
* half is the safety net for any overlay that wraps a dialog without marking
|
|
|
|
|
* itself, and is deliberately not asked of `<body>`/`<html>` — those contain
|
|
|
|
|
* every portal in the app and would make the answer "blocked" always.
|
|
|
|
|
*/
|
|
|
|
|
function coveredByBlocker(top: Element, doc: Document): boolean {
|
|
|
|
|
const nearest = top.closest(BLOCKING_SELECTOR);
|
|
|
|
|
if (nearest && isOnScreen(nearest)) return true;
|
|
|
|
|
if (top === doc.body || top === doc.documentElement) return false;
|
|
|
|
|
const inside = top.querySelector(BLOCKING_SELECTOR);
|
|
|
|
|
return inside !== null && isOnScreen(inside);
|
|
|
|
|
}
